Section 470.0395, Florida Statutes 2004

1470.0395  Branch chapels.--Notwithstanding the provisions of s. 470.024, any licensed establishment operating a branch chapel on June 30, 1979, in accordance with the law then in effect, as determined by the board, may continue to operate such branch chapel for the sole and exclusive purpose of providing and holding funeral services.

History.--ss. 3, 4, ch. 79-231; s. 1, ch. 81-303; s. 2, ch. 81-318; s. 1, ch. 89-8; ss. 35, 122, ch. 93-399; s. 4, ch. 2000-332; s. 97, ch. 2004-301.

1Note.--Section 97, ch. 2004-301, renumbered s. 470.0395 as s. 497.392 and amended the section, effective October 1, 2005, to read:

497.392  Branch chapels.--Notwithstanding the provisions of s. 497.380, any licensed establishment operating a branch chapel on June 30, 1979, in accordance with the law then in effect, as determined by the licensing authority, may continue to operate such branch chapel for the sole and exclusive purpose of providing and holding funeral services.
